Title

Towards Green Video: Energy-Saving Potentials in Streaming

Abstract
The widespread adoption of digital media, particularly video streaming, has introduced technical complexities and raised concerns about energy efficiency across the streaming supply chain. Video streaming devices have become an integral part of our daily lives, providing access to visual content on various devices, from handheld gadgets to large TV screens. However, their pervasive presence also contributes significantly to energy consumption. This research paper addresses the challenges associated with energy efficiency in video streaming by proposing methods for efficient, reproducible, and reliable energy measurements on streaming devices. To achieve this, we introduce a framework designed for automated energy measurements of video streams. Through experiments, we analyze the energy consumption of streaming devices using a predefined set of reference content. Our goal is to identify the most influential factors affecting power consumption and derive practical methods to enable more sustainable and efficient streaming practices.
